The third tour to celebrate one and a half years since the game joyfully raced into our lives is about to launch. Mario and mates will be going bumper to bumper around the new Ninja Hideaway course on the Ninja Tour. Here’s what to expect, Kart fans.

Enjoy the view, then race
The Ninja Hideaway course takes you through the inside of Ninja Manor and onto the tiled roof outside; the route is divided into upper and lower sections and features beautiful Japanese-style rooms and illuminated cherry blossoms. Take a drift through Ninja Manor
Ninja Manor is full of unexpected obstacles – like when a ceiling suddenly drops from above with scary shurikens (or ninja stars) sticking out from it.
Keep an eye out for the new character, Ninja Shy Guy – he can turn into a banana thanks to some outstanding shape-shifting skills.

Fly like a ninja
While there’s pleasure in racing on the ground, nothing quite beats soaring through the sky. This tour introduces the Ninja Scroll, a glider with the word Nindou written on it that flies through the air.

When flying with the Ninja Scroll, look carefully at the course below to find the best place to land – if, for example, you touch down on a curve in the track you’ll be perfectly positioned to overtake your competitors.

Meet new drivers and karts
As well as Ninja Shy Guy, the Ninja Tour also introduces new drivers Green Shy Guy and King Bob-omb (Gold), whose special Coin Box skill generously spreads coins around.

There are several new karts in the mix as well: the green Jade Hop Rod has the face of a frog, the red-coloured Crimson Hop Rod appears in a special offer and the adorable Sakura Quickshaw has a pink cherry-blossom-patterned body.
